Two dead in Hong Kong amid extreme rain and flash floods that also struck southern China

IndiaTimes Friday, 8 September 2023
Heavy rain in Hong Kong and southern China has caused flooding, with two deaths reported in Hong Kong. The extreme weather is expected to continue until midnight, causing widespread flooding and disruptions to public transport. Hong Kong has recorded over 600mm of rain so far, a quarter of its average annual rainfall. Videos on social media show flooded streets and submerged vehicles.
